ChickTech Orange County is holding a two-day event for up to 100 high school girls in Fall 2018 on November 17th to the 18th. This event is a fun, positive learning experience designed to build participants’ confidence in their technical abilities, provide positive role models, and create connections with other young women from Orange County and surrounding areas.

The role of ChickTech Workshop Leaders is to create and lead a fun, creative, project-based tech/STEM workshop that leaves our high school participants with a strong sense of accomplishment and confidence to challenge the tech industry. The participants (high school girls) will be able to bring an item back home to showcase their accomplishment.

This particular Workshop is about teaching a soft circuits class depending on the volunteer's interest based on previous workshops. A list of the materials has already been created. A curriculum has already been created and we need someone to lead this workshop! It can be you! We are open to tailoring it to your needs as well.

Mission Statement

ChickTech is dedicated to retaining women and non-binary people in the technology workforce and increasing the number of people of marginalized genders pursuing technology-based careers.

Description

ChickTech is a multi-generational community helping each other become technology creators. We facilitate hands-on technology-centric events and mentorship to empower, support, and increase the confidence of girls, women, and non-binary folks. Through our programs, we build community, empower participants to see themselves as leaders, and provide networking and mentoring opportunities in the rapidly growing tech industry.
